Kansas Co-Operative Council
The Kansas Cooperative Council, based in Topeka, KS, is dedicated to enhancing the performance of cooperative organizations and improving member experiences through various educational initiatives. Their offerings include programs such as Coop Academy, tailored cooperative training, and leadership symposiums designed for employees, interns, and board members.
In addition to educational resources, the Council promotes cooperative values through events like Coop Month and recognizes outstanding contributions with awards such as the Century Coop Award. Their commitment to advocacy and development underscores their role as a vital resource for the cooperative community in Kansas.
